Internal Memo — Budget Request, Operations. To department heads: Operations is requesting an additional allocation for the Brindlemoor warehouse upgrade, covering racking, safety lighting, and a conveyor refit. The request has been costed carefully against two contractor quotes and phased over two quarters to limit cash impact. Please submit comments before Friday's review so the committee can decide promptly. A confidential note follows below.

board note of tawig-bajof: The renewal with Ralixix Holdings closes at $10 million a year, 20 percent above the last contract. Project Druix slips by two quarters because of the tooling delay.

FAQ: Why does the Pondwire client resend credentials on websocket reconnect?

The reconnect handler replays the original auth frame rather than requesting a fresh token. This is tracked as a known defect, not an exploit vector, since frames stay inside the TLS tunnel. To inspect the captured reconnect traces, decrypt the archive with the passphrase below.

unlock words, hahip-baduf: holwyn-istath-julvan

Team,

Training spend for next year must be locked by month-end. Proposal: 4% of payroll, split 60/40 between technical certification and leadership tracks at the Verrow Institute. Department heads submit headcount-based requests by Friday. No carry-over of unused allocations this cycle. Kestrel Division's lab safety refreshers are mandatory and funded centrally. Everything else competes for the pool. Push back now or hold your peace.

The allocation assumptions tie directly to the confidential note below.

— Darra Quill, COO

board note of bawep-tajef: Queniusek Systems plans to raise the Quenvan list price by 53.1 percent in March. The pricing group signed off on a budget of $176.4 million for Project Drueth. The renewal with Casionix Partners closes at $142.5 million a year, 8.3 percent below the last contract. Project Fraax slips by six weeks because of the tooling delay.